What is libiomp-dev
libiomp-dev is:
The runtime is the part of the OpenMP implementation that your code is linked against, and that manages the multiple threads in an OpenMP program while it is executing.
This package has been replaced by the LLVM sources. This is the Intel version moved under the LLVM umbrella. This is a dependency package.

Install libiomp-dev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get
using the following command.
sudo apt-get update
After updating apt database, We can install libiomp-dev
using apt-get
by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install libiomp-dev

How To Uninstall libiomp-dev on Ubuntu 18.04
To uninstall only the libiomp-dev
package we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get remove libiomp-dev
Uninstall libiomp-dev And Its Dependencies
To uninstall libiomp-dev
and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Ubuntu 18.04, we can use the command below: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ove libiomp-dev
Remove libiomp-dev Configurations and Data
To remove libiomp-dev
configuration and data from Ubuntu 18.04 we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y purge libiomp-dev
Remove libiomp-dev configuration, data, and all of its dependencies
We can use the following command to remove libiomp-dev
config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ge libiomp-dev
